Notes on Ship


Description CaptureBG

"Extract of a letter from Captain Boyle, Commander of His Majesty's Sloop Kangaroo, to Rear-Admiral Sir John Orde, Bart, dated in Mount's Bay,
the 10 th of April, 1797.
Have the Honour to inform yon, that, in consequence of your orders of the 8-th Instant to proceed to sea, on the 9th, at Eight P. M. the Lizard bearing N. W. Two Leagues, I fell in with and captured La Sophie, French Cutter Privateer, pierced for Fourteen 4-Pounders, (8 of which (he hove overboard) and having 40 Men. She sailed from Havre de Grace on the 7 th Instant, being her first cruize, and had made no Captures.
